The following table gives some examples of some typical
Linear Scale values for common accelerometer sensitivities.:
Obtaining a readout in units other
than “g”.
If the desired linear units are different from those provided
by the manufacturer, m/s
2
for example, calculate the
sensitivity in those units, Volt/m/s
2
, and use that value in the
equation for Linear Scale.
Setup of Linear Units Readout. The items to be defined to implement this feature are
“Linear Units” and “Linear Scale” which appear in the FFT
Edit Settings menu as shown in “Settings Menu” on page
12-1 and on the screen as shown below.
Sensitivity Linear Scale (dB) Units
100 mV/g 20 dB g
50 mV/g 26 dB g
25 mV/g 32 dB g
10 mV/g 40 dB g
5 mV/g 46 dB g
14.0 mV/Pa 37.08 dB Pa (2540)
44.5 mV/Pa 27.03 dB Pa (377B41)
11.7 mV/Pa 38.64 dB Pa (2559)
47.5 mV/Pa 26.47dB Pa (377A60)
